THE AFFAIR
Fat Agnes snitched. I knew she would.
We saw Nick Smith kissing Pastor
Roy’s wife out by the dumpster between the church and the soup kitchen.
They saw that we saw and begged us
to let them gently tell Roy. I was glad
they didn’t want me to lie. Judge me!
They would have had to pay me off.
I’m honest. I would have admitted to
God that I lied for the money. If they
had paid us – they might have gotten
away with it. But Agnes snitched.
In just 10 minutes, Roy stormed into
the soup kitchen and punched Nick hard in the face! The fight broke three chairs and started a secondary fork fight!
Forks flew between hungry locals who
probably threw mashed potatoes in
high school. When things finally calmed,
Roy was crying. His wife was crying.
Nick wasn’t so handsome with a
pummeled face. Roy, finally spoke up.
“All these years…I thought you loved me?”
Nick answered, “I do, Roy. I do.”
